嵌入式蓝桥杯第十四届省赛
时间: 2025-04-04 16:05:18 浏览: 99
### 关于蓝桥杯第十四届省赛嵌入式方向的大纲与解题报告
#### 1. 蓝桥杯嵌入式竞赛大纲概述
蓝桥杯嵌入式竞赛主要面向电子信息及相关专业的学生,其竞赛内容涵盖了硬件设计、嵌入式编程以及实际工程应用等多个方面。根据往年的竞赛安排,嵌入式方向的比赛通常涉及单片机开发、传感器接口技术、通信协议实现等内容[^2]。
具体来说,第十四届蓝桥杯省赛嵌入式方向的考试大纲可能包括但不限于以下几个部分:
- **基础知识**:C/C++程序设计基础、数据结构基本概念。
- **硬件平台**:基于指定开发板(如STC系列单片机或其他官方推荐型号)的实际操作能力测试。
- **功能模块设计**:要求选手完成特定的功能模块开发,比如LED控制、按键检测、串口通信等。
- **综合项目实践**:考察参赛者将多个子功能集成到一起的能力,形成完整的解决方案。
#### 2. 第十四届省赛题目分析
虽然具体的第十四届省赛嵌入式方向题目尚未公开全部细节,但从以往的经验来看,这类试题往往具有较强的实用性,贴近工业应用场景。以下是几个典型的例子:
- 设计一个温湿度监测系统,通过DS18B20温度传感器采集环境参数,并利用LCD显示屏显示结果。
- 实现红外遥控接收电路的设计及其对应的解码算法编写。
- 构建简单的无线传输网络模型,采用nRF24L01模块完成两节点间的数据交换实验。
这些任务不仅考验学生的理论功底,还对其动手能力和创新思维提出了较高要求。
#### 3. 解题思路及技巧总结
针对上述类型的考题,在准备过程中可以采取如下策略来提高成绩:
- 加强对常用外设驱动的学习掌握程度,熟悉各类典型外围器件的工作原理和配置方法;
- 注重代码质量优化,确保逻辑清晰简洁的同时兼顾效率;
- 积累丰富的调试经验,学会快速定位问题所在并有效解决;
另外值得注意的是,撰写详尽规范的技术文档也是评分环节中的重要组成部分之一,因此建议平时多练习描述自己的设计方案和技术路线图。
```c
// 示例代码片段展示如何初始化UART串口通讯设置
void UART_Init(void){
UCA0CTL1 |= UCSWRST; // Software reset enabled
UCA0BR0 = 104; // Baud Rate calculation (assuming SMCLK=1MHz)
UCA0MCTLW = UCOS16 | UCBRS_7 ; // Modulation setting for better accuracy
UCA0CTL1 &= ~UCSWRST; // Initialize USCI state machine after configuration done.
}
```
以上仅为一小部分内容示范,请结合实际情况灵活调整复习重点。
阅读全文
相关推荐

















